Loose rear view mirror

The rear view on my 04 TL is loose where it mounts to the windshield. Is there a bolt/screw to tighten up?

At night I see shaking headlights in the mirror when I hit bumps.

I took the covers off and didn't see anything that I could tighten. Again its loose where the post connects to the roof/windshield. From the post to the mirror itself is actually tight.

I had a loose mirror after getting the windshield replace. There is a metal (base) already glue onto the windshield. The mirror mounts on that metal base by put it up under the metal base and pushing the mirror up onto the base. You may have to push it kinda hard for it to go all the way up. Mine seems to be holding for now.

Well I just figured out how to get it off of the base and I decided to put a little bit of silicone where the mount and the 'claws' (tabs on post that grab mount). We'll see how that works, I think another member had good results doing this.
